Augmentation of Pesticide in Activated Sludge/
To compare the effect of different concentration of metaldehyde on the microbial growth in activated sludge. To study the growth profile of microorganisms in optimum pesticide. To study the physiochemical factors that affect degradation of pesticide in activated sludge.
